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Solutions on the web

via Spring JIRA by Abhishek Dhote, 2 years ago
Could not create Oracle LOB; nested exception is org.springframework.dao.InvalidDataAccessApiUsageException: Couldn't initialize OracleLobHandler because Oracle driver classes are not available. Note that OracleLobHandler requires Oracle JDBC driver 9i or higher!; nested exception is java.lang.ClassNotFoundException: oracle.sql.BLOB
via Spring JIRA by Abhishek Dhote, 1 year ago
Could not create Oracle LOB; nested exception is org.springframework.dao.InvalidDataAccessApiUsageException: Couldn't initialize OracleLobHandler because Oracle driver classes are not available. Note that OracleLobHandler requires Oracle JDBC driver 9i or higher!; nested exception is java.lang.ClassNotFoundException: oracle.sql.BLOB
java.lang.ClassNotFoundException: oracle.sql.BLOB	at org.apache.felix.framework.searchpolicy.ModuleImpl.findClassOrResourceByDelegation(ModuleImpl.java:627)	at org.apache.felix.framework.searchpolicy.ModuleImpl.access$100(ModuleImpl.java:61)	at org.apache.felix.framework.searchpolicy.ModuleImpl$ModuleClassLoader.loadClass(ModuleImpl.java:1469)	at java.lang.ClassLoader.loadClass(Unknown Source)	at org.springframework.jdbc.support.lob.OracleLobHandler.initOracleDriverClasses(OracleLobHandler.java:150)	at org.springframework.jdbc.support.lob.OracleLobHandler$OracleLobCreator.createLob(OracleLobHandler.java:339)	at org.springframework.jdbc.support.lob.OracleLobHandler$OracleLobCreator.setBlobAsBytes(OracleLobHandler.java:220)	at com.hp.exstream.cc.dao.util.BlobActionType.nullSafeSetInternal(BlobActionType.java:96)	at org.springframework.orm.hibernate3.support.AbstractLobType.nullSafeSet(AbstractLobType.java:180)	at org.hibernate.type.CustomType.nullSafeSet(CustomType.java:169)	at org.hibernate.persister.entity.AbstractEntityPersister.dehydrate(AbstractEntityPersister.java:2025)	at org.hibernate.persister.entity.AbstractEntityPersister.insert(AbstractEntityPersister.java:2271)	at org.hibernate.persister.entity.AbstractEntityPersister.insert(AbstractEntityPersister.java:2688)	at org.hibernate.action.EntityInsertAction.execute(EntityInsertAction.java:79)	at org.hibernate.engine.ActionQueue.execute(ActionQueue.java:279)	at org.hibernate.engine.ActionQueue.executeActions(ActionQueue.java:263)	at org.hibernate.engine.ActionQueue.executeActions(ActionQueue.java:167)	at org.hibernate.event.def.AbstractFlushingEventListener.performExecutions(AbstractFlushingEventListener.java:321)	at org.hibernate.event.def.DefaultFlushEventListener.onFlush(DefaultFlushEventListener.java:50)	at org.hibernate.impl.SessionImpl.flush(SessionImpl.java:1027)	at org.hibernate.impl.SessionImpl.managedFlush(SessionImpl.java:365)	at org.hibernate.transaction.JDBCTransaction.commit(JDBCTransaction.java:137)	at org.springframework.orm.hibernate3.HibernateTransactionManager.doCommit(HibernateTransactionManager.java:655)	at org.springframework.transaction.support.AbstractPlatformTransactionManager.processCommit(AbstractPlatformTransactionManager.java:732)	at org.springframework.transaction.support.AbstractPlatformTransactionManager.commit(AbstractPlatformTransactionManager.java:701)	at org.springframework.transaction.support.TransactionTemplate.execute(TransactionTemplate.java:140)	at sun.reflect.GeneratedMethodAccessor38.invoke(Unknown Source)	at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)	at java.lang.reflect.Method.invoke(Unknown Source)	at org.springframework.aop.support.AopUtils.invokeJoinpointUsingReflection(AopUtils.java:307)	at org.springframework.osgi.service.importer.support.internal.aop.ServiceInvoker.doInvoke(ServiceInvoker.java:58)	at org.springframework.osgi.service.importer.support.internal.aop.ServiceInvoker.invoke(ServiceInvoker.java:62)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171)	at org.springframework.aop.support.DelegatingIntroductionInterceptor.doProceed(DelegatingIntroductionInterceptor.java:131)	at org.springframework.aop.support.DelegatingIntroductionInterceptor.invoke(DelegatingIntroductionInterceptor.java:119)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171)	at org.springframework.osgi.service.util.internal.aop.ServiceTCCLInterceptor.invokeUnprivileged(ServiceTCCLInterceptor.java:56)	at org.springframework.osgi.service.util.internal.aop.ServiceTCCLInterceptor.invoke(ServiceTCCLInterceptor.java:39)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171)	at org.springframework.osgi.service.importer.support.LocalBundleContextAdvice.invoke(LocalBundleContextAdvice.java:59)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171)	at org.springframework.aop.support.DelegatingIntroductionInterceptor.doProceed(DelegatingIntroductionInterceptor.java:131)	at org.springframework.aop.support.DelegatingIntroductionInterceptor.invoke(DelegatingIntroductionInterceptor.java:119)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171)	at org.springframework.aop.framework.Cglib2AopProxy$FixedChainStaticTargetInterceptor.intercept(Cglib2AopProxy.java:582)	at org.springframework.transaction.support.TransactionTemplate$$EnhancerByCGLIB$$2e8c72f0.execute()	at com.hp.exstream.cc.server.actions.chain.ActionHandlerTransactionProxy.handleAction(ActionHandlerTransactionProxy.java:49)	at com.hp.exstream.cc.server.actions.chain.ActionHandlerTransactionProxy$$FastClassByCGLIB$$b074e067.invoke()	at net.sf.cglib.proxy.MethodProxy.invoke(MethodProxy.java:149)	at org.springframework.aop.framework.Cglib2AopProxy$CglibMethodInvocation.invokeJoinpoint(Cglib2AopProxy.java:700)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:149)	at org.springframework.aop.aspectj.MethodInvocationProceedingJoinPoint.proceed(MethodInvocationProceedingJoinPoint.java:77)	at com.hp.exstream.cc.server.aspects.UserRightsChecker.handleCreateEntityAction(UserRightsChecker.java:656)	at com.hp.exstream.cc.server.aspects.UserRightsChecker.handleScheduleAction(UserRightsChecker.java:383)	at com.hp.exstream.cc.server.aspects.UserRightsChecker.checkActionHandling(UserRightsChecker.java:126)	at sun.reflect.GeneratedMethodAccessor37.invoke(Unknown Source)	at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)	at java.lang.reflect.Method.invoke(Unknown Source)	at org.springframework.aop.aspectj.AbstractAspectJAdvice.invokeAdviceMethodWithGivenArgs(AbstractAspectJAdvice.java:627)	at org.springframework.aop.aspectj.AbstractAspectJAdvice.invokeAdviceMethod(AbstractAspectJAdvice.java:616)	at org.springframework.aop.aspectj.AspectJAroundAdvice.invoke(AspectJAroundAdvice.java:64)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:160)	at org.springframework.aop.aspectj.MethodInvocationProceedingJoinPoint.proceed(MethodInvocationProceedingJoinPoint.java:77)	at com.hp.exstream.cc.server.aspects.LicenseChecker.checkActionHandling(LicenseChecker.java:204)	at sun.reflect.GeneratedMethodAccessor36.invoke(Unknown Source)	at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)	at java.lang.reflect.Method.invoke(Unknown Source)	at org.springframework.aop.aspectj.AbstractAspectJAdvice.invokeAdviceMethodWithGivenArgs(AbstractAspectJAdvice.java:627)	at org.springframework.aop.aspectj.AbstractAspectJAdvice.invokeAdviceMethod(AbstractAspectJAdvice.java:616)	at org.springframework.aop.aspectj.AspectJAroundAdvice.invoke(AspectJAroundAdvice.java:64)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:160)	at org.springframework.aop.interceptor.ExposeInvocationInterceptor.invoke(ExposeInvocationInterceptor.java:89)	at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171)	at org.springframework.aop.framework.Cglib2AopProxy$DynamicAdvisedInterceptor.intercept(Cglib2AopProxy.java:635)	at com.hp.exstream.cc.server.actions.chain.ActionHandlerTransactionProxy$$EnhancerByCGLIB$$88dc6775.handleAction()	at com.hp.exstream.cc.server.actions.chain.AbstractActionHandler.handleAction(AbstractActionHandler.java:21)	at com.hp.exstream.cc.server.actions.chain.ActionHandlerLockProxy.handleAction(ActionHandlerLockProxy.java:26)	at com.hp.exstream.cc.server.actions.chain.ActionHandlerJamonProxy.handleAction(ActionHandlerJamonProxy.java:41)	at com.hp.exstream.cc.server.actions.ActionExecutionServiceImpl.executeAction(ActionExecutionServiceImpl.java:68)	at com.hp.exstream.cc.server.actions.ThreadPoolActionExecutionServiceImpl$1.call(ThreadPoolActionExecutionServiceImpl.java:71)	at com.hp.exstream.cc.server.actions.ThreadPoolActionExecutionServiceImpl$1.call(ThreadPoolActionExecutionServiceImpl.java:70)	at java.util.concurrent.FutureTask$Sync.innerRun(Unknown Source)	at java.util.concurrent.FutureTask.run(Unknown Source)	at java.util.concurrent.ThreadPoolExecutor$Worker.runTask(Unknown Source)	at java.util.concurrent.ThreadPoolExecutor$Worker.run(Unknown Source)	at java.lang.Thread.run(Unknown Source)